I am attempting to recompile PHP 4.2.3 on HP-UX 11.00 for
connectivity to both a MySQL and a remote Oracle server.  I am not having
much luck with this right now.  Currently I am getting a couple of different
errors that are of concern for me.  First of all, in the Apache error log I
am seeing the following entry every time I start the Apache server:

        [Tue Dec 17 09:42:39 2002] [warn] module php4_module is already
loaded, skipping

        I am not sure as to why I am receiving this error.  I know that PHP
is only compiled as a module, because it does not show up in a httpd -l.  I
am wondering if this is a result of some kind of syntax error in my
httpd.conf file.

        The big problem though is getting PHP to compile completely again.
I know that on HP there is an issue with the extension on the php library.
It has something to do with .sl as opposed to .so, but I cannot remember
exactly what it is and for some reason I can't seem to find the
documentation on it this time around.  Any help in the right direction here
would be most appreciated.
